Again to the query

This doesn’t reply my query of how a lot we’d must earn £1,000 a month. A part of it’s simple. It will depend on the return we obtain. If we will get 8% yearly, we’d want a pot of £150,000. With solely 2%, it will take £600,000.

The more durable questions are how can we get there, and the way lengthy would possibly it take?

I selected the two% determine because it’s the UK’s inflation goal. After we obtain that, rates of interest ought to come method down. I believe 2% would possibly nonetheless be optimistic for a Money ISA, however I can go together with optimism.

The 8% is near the forecast dividend yield for Authorized & Basic (LSE: LGEN) shares.

What compounding can do

What about investing half an ISA allowance a 12 months of £10,000, cut up month-to-month? That a lot into money financial savings paying 2% a 12 months might take 40 years to recover from the £600,000 threshold for producing £1,000 a month.

However in a inventory like Authorized & Basic paying dividends of 8%? With all dividend money reinvested, we might hit the required £150,000 in simply 14 years. Feels like a straightforward alternative, proper?

Nicely, Authorized & Basic’s dividends aren’t assured. It may be a cyclical enterprise, and there’ll be dangerous years among the many good, for positive. Will there be occasions when no dividend in any respect is paid? I’d say there’s a superb likelihood. Monetary shares suffered within the 2020 inventory market crash, and we will see the sharp Authorized & Basic dive within the chart above.

Inventory market diversification

I’d by no means put all my money in Authorized & Basic, or in anybody inventory. However with the FTSE 100 returning a median 6.9% yearly over the previous 20 years, I’d say the chances favour traders going for a diversified Shares and Shares ISA.
